Chamber of Commerce hosts recruitment fair for law & economics students

About 24 companies will participate in a business-student meeting on Thursday at the Luxembourg Chamber of Commerce in Kirchberg aimed at law and economics students.

The event organised by two student associations aims to prepare young people for a job interview, explained Sabrina Sousa, president of the National Association of Law Students (ANELD) in an interview with Radio Latina.

The event has borne fruit which is proved by the number of students and indeed businesses, that have signed up.

This will be the 33rd business and student meeting taking place from midday at the Chamber of Commerce in Kirchberg until 6pm. Entries can be made during the event.

The fair for the recruitment of law and economics students will be attended by representatives of the Ministry of Economy, Fedil – Business Federation Luxembourg, Seqvoia, Luxinnovation and the Office of Intellectual Property.
